    Essential Strategies for Winning Technical Interviews in Engineering

    Preparing for 転職 未経験可 a technical interview in engineering requires far more than memorizing facts. It involves articulating complex ideas simply, structured problem solving, and the capacity to adapt under pressure. Start by revisiting fundamentals tied to the role. Whether it's data structures and algorithms, make sure your fundamentals are solid. Practice vocalizing your understanding—this reinforces retention and sharpens your ability to convey ideas clearly.


    Practice dedicating time to problem-solving drills. Use tools like LeetCode, HackerRank, or CodeSignal. Don't just prioritizing output—focus on your reasoning journey. Explain each decision as you make it. Interviewers want to observe your problem-solving framework, not just if your code runs without errors. If you get stuck, articulate your line of reasoning and seek confirmation on constraints. This proves you’re analytical and indicates strong teamwork skills.


    Be ready to walk through your portfolio projects. Know the why behind every decision. Be prepared to contrast alternatives, challenges you faced, and the strategies you employed. Use the context-action-result structure to keep your narratives tight. This keeps your answers results-driven and memorable. Also, be acknowledge limitations truthfully. It’s better to recognize limits with a growth mindset than to pretend to understand.


    Time management matters. During coding interviews, request requirements upfront, then outline a high-level plan before diving into code. This prevents you from going down the wrong path. If you’re working on a whiteboard, write clean, readable code. Use intuitive naming conventions and add contextual notes. Test your solution with sample inputs, including edge cases. This signals engineering rigor.

    Finally, prepare questions to ask your interviewers. Asking smart questions about current challenges shows professional enthusiasm. It also lets you assess cultural and technical alignment.


    Remember, a technical interview is fail exam. It’s an platform to show your learning mindset and how you learn and work with others. Stay centered, be yourself, and treat each question as a collaborative exchange rather than an quiz. With dedicated preparation and the positive, curious perspective, you’ll not only succeed in interviews but grow as an engineer in the process.
